External A pillar trim clips - which ones???
Hi all - the scuttle panel on my D4 is shot and I want to refurbish it. I have found a handy guide on how to remove it and I know I have to remove the A pillar trims. I fully expect some of the clips to break when I pop it off so in anticipation of this I want to get a few replacements. Does anyone know which are the correct clips?? A photo would be helpful too!!!

You can get the scuttle off without taking the pillar trims off, start on the passenger side you can bend it enough to get it off, when refitting start with the driver's side.
Just replaced mine that way 2 minute job 👍
